Consumers have more choices than ever in healthcare. Physicians, dentists, physical therapists, athletic trainers, physician assistants, therapists, psychologists, psychiatrists and others may find an expensive marketing campaign out of reach. A public relations program can be the best way to attract new patients and it doesn't have to break the bank.

The new JW PR Toolkits series includes a kit specifically for medical businesses and professionals, with insider information to help them create and implement low-cost PR campaigns.
